Liste der Anhänge anzeigen (Anzahl: 4)
Google Fonts lokal einbinden
Hallo Zusammen
Zuerst mal, ich bin mit Contao nicht vertraut (eher WordPress) muss jedoch nun kurzfristig und schnell bei einer Contao-Installation (Vers.3.5) die Google Fonts lokal einbinden. Dazu habe ich mir im Contao-Handbuch die entspr. Anleitung und über „ggogle webfonts helper” die Schriften heruntergeladen und in ein selbst erzeugtes Verzeichnis „fonts” kopiert. Dazu den css-code heruntergeladen und in einer neuen css-Datei namnes „style” eingebaut und in das m.E. allgemeinen css-Verzeichnis gelegt. Leider klappt das überhaupt nicht und ich steige nicht dahinter. Alle Pfadangaben stimmen trotzdem erhalte die Meldung, dass immer noch Schriften geladen werden (Bildschirmfoto-1). Um die Verzeichnisstruktur der vorliegenden Contao-Installation anschaulich zu machen, habe ich Screenshots der Struktur gemacht aus denen ersichtlich sein sollte wo ich die fonts (Bildschirmfoto-fonts) und die css-Datei (Bildschirmfoto-css-datei) gespeichert habe. Auch ein Screenshot der css-Datei ist dabei (Bildschirmfoto-style, allerdings nur ein Ausschnitt).
Ich habe mich zwar intensiv im Forum zu diesem Thema bereits umgesehen, jedoch nichts gefunden was mir geholfen hätte.
Liste der Anhänge anzeigen (Anzahl: 1)
Danke euch allen. Die Screenshots dürften inzwischen hochgeladen sein. Und es ist wohl auch so, dass die Fonts lokal eingebunden sind, trotzdem gibt es immer noch eine Verbindung zum Google Server (wie auch aus dem Quelltext - siehe screenshot - zu entnehmen ist). Womöglich liegt es daran, dass - wie aus den Entwicklertools zu entnehmen ist - der Schriftschnitt Open Sans 600 nicht gefunden wird (obwohl er doch lokal vorhanden ist?). Als ergänzende Info hier noch die Domain um die es sich handelt "www.fairsicherung.de".
planepix schreibt, dass es bei den "Seitenlayouts" die Option geben soll Google Fonts einzubinden und zu laden, ich finde jedoch dort keine Option?! (muss mich aber auch korrigieren die Contao-Version mit der ich mich befassen muss ist die Version 3.3.5). Auch in den "Einstellungen" finde ich keine entsprechende Option.
Ich finde auch keinen Hinweis, dass die Links (die "roten" aus dem "Bildschirmfoto-quelltext") manuell gesetzt wurden (lassen sich diese vielleicht "manuell" entfernen?). Google Maps und Youtube werden auf der Website nirgendwo verwendet.
Liste der Anhänge anzeigen (Anzahl: 1)
Hallo Zusammen
Den (die) Übeltäter habe ich gefunden (bei Layout > Themes > Seitenlayouts) und die "Google Webfonts" entfernt. Somit ist die Verbindung zum Google Server gekappt und die Seite abmahnsicher. Leider werden die lokal installierten Fonts nicht gefunden, weshalb die Seite nun in der Schritart Times erscheint.
Aber das verstehe ich nicht: Die Fonts liegen doch eindeutig in diesem Verzeichnis files > Fairsicherung > fonts (siehe screenshot "Bildschirmfoto-fonts.jpg). Und auch im style.css wird dieser Pfad aufgeführt (screenshot "Bildschirmfoto-style.jpg" oder nun auch als style.css hochgeladene Datei), trotzdem werden die Schriften nicht gefunden...
Stehe ich denn so auf dem Schlauch?
Liste der Anhänge anzeigen (Anzahl: 1)
Einfach folgendes in der CSS angeben für deine font locations in url() in der CSS:
Entweder:
1. Relative Pfade
HTML-Code:
url('../../fonts/open-sans-v34-latin-600.woff2')
2. Absolute Pfade
HTML-Code:
url('/files/Fairsicherung/fonts/open-sans-v34-latin-600.woff2')
Beides sollte gehen.
Hier nochmal eine Veranschaulichung:
Anhang 25933
MfG